Overview

Fresh-minted college graduate Franny Chase subsists as a sales clerk in a la-di-da West LA bed/bath boutique. She dreams of becoming a professional writer. So when she lands a position as live-in assistant to the engagingly eccentric Dorothy Gaines, who charges her with the task of ghostwriting her memoir, Franny feels like she's finally on her way. But life in the grand Gaines house may not be the smooth road to success Franny hopes for, marked as it is with uneasy new friendships, impetuous trysts, precarious alliances, and secrets. Each complication reveals her self-doubts, desires, and ultimately, her strengths. Dance With Me, Franny Nice Shirt is a turbulent love story, a slightly sideways spiritual journey, and an introspective excursion told with Elizabeth Kelly Stephenson's signature humor and grace.

Author Information

Elizabeth Kelly Stephenson is the author of The Trouble with Truth: A Memoir, and Liz Bitz: Love, Lust, Lies, Family Ties, and other Ills, a novel. She served for fifteen years as executive director of The Crisis Hotline in Ketchum, Idaho, work that inspired her to write about the issues that compelled callers to honor a total stranger with their stories. She lives in Bend, Oregon, with her husband Richard and a thriving menagerie of cats and dogs.
